Good day.
Which receiver do you have? VIP5662w HD PVR or VIP7802?
If you have a VIP 5662w HD PVR & it is replaced, all of your recordings are permanently lost.
There is nothing you can do to save any of your settings. If you have access to your Favourite or Menu settings, you can record them for ease of use in setting up your replacement.
You will not loose any information that you have stored in your PVR Series settings & that you have scheduled to record in the future.
You will need to set up most items in your Menu > Settings. E.g. Customize Guide, Favourites, audio & visual, parental controls, etc.
The VIP 7802 box stores it's recordings on the Cloud PVR. These will not be lost unless you choose to delete them or the storage time & capacity storage space limits have reached their maximum.

Good Day & Welcome to the Bell Community Forum.
Unfortunately that is correct. There is no way to recover recordings that are stored on any Bell Fibe PVR if the equipment is changed out or replaced. The VIP7802 Fibe box will store recordings on the Cloud PVR for 60 days.
Assuming you have the storage space, you can download & access recordings from the PVR for off line viewing with the Fibe TV app. You would not be able to keep them for perpetuity as they are only available for 60 days after which they expire.
I am not aware of any method on Bell Fibe that would enable you to re-record downloaded recordings from your mobile device.
